CI note: websocket compression on Pondmark gateway

We enabled permessage-deflate in build 14xx to cut bandwidth on the Pondmark event stream. It worked, but CI soak tests showed CPU climbing 30% under load and memory fragmentation in the compressor contexts. For small payloads (<512 bytes) compression is a net loss, so the gateway now skips it below that threshold. If soak tests regress again, check context takeover settings before blaming the kernel. The first build with the threshold logic is recorded below.

build token for tawip-yageg: htk9_92ac43d42

Action item (SEC-9): The Bucketeer assignment service logged raw user identifiers alongside experiment arms, exposing assignment mappings to anyone with log access. Remediation: hash identifiers before logging, rotate the salt quarterly, and restrict the experiment-logs index to the Lanthorn analytics group. Owner: platform security, due end of month. Verification steps and the log-scrubbing script are documented on the internal page here.

dashboard of kafop-yagep = https://jira.zemvarsys.internal/pages/pages/pages/display/cc87

Fan-out backpressure for the Quillet notifier: when the queue depth crosses the soft limit, the dispatcher sheds low-priority pushes and batches the rest at 500ms intervals. Reviewer should confirm the shed counter is exported and that retries respect the jitter window. Once merged, the release artifact gets re-signed by the pipeline, which expects the deploy key shown below.

deploy key for bawep-yawif: bky6_GQhaSt